Oliva Serie O Double Toro
"Nice Relaxing Full Bodied Smoke"
Handsome and simple appearance. Flavorful, with excellent undertones of coffee and sharp spices. Construction is decent. However does not hold the ash very well. Recommend keeping ash to a maximum of no more than a half inch.

Oliva Serie O Robusto
"Started out Great, but..."
What's going on here? Not usual for me to give a negative review, as I normally choose wisely. I had really enjoyed the first few of these robusto maduro cigars. Good smell and an acceptable ash. For the money, they were a fantastic buy, with good flavor and a decent draw. Lately, the draw takes too much effort which in turn brings in too much heat, and that has changed the flavor of this once nice burning cigar. I have tried a poker, but the roll is very tight in some areas, which has led to small cracks when trying to push in the poker. My humidor is always on target with humidity and temp, so I have even tried to let them rest. But, to no avail on these boxes. I hope Oliva is attentive to this issue, I have had a lot of respect for their brand of cigars in the past. I just can't justify the effort needed to smoke these and sort through the better ones to do so. This will not deter me from the Oliva NUB's. Those seem to have a good control on them for now. Cigar smoking should be pleasure... not a chore! Thanks to Rene` @ FSS for listening!
